Carolina Panthers Fire GM Scott Fitterer

The Carolina Panthers have parted ways with general manager Scott Fitterer. The team is now going through a complete overhaul, letting go of head coach Frank Reich earlier this season. The Panthers went 2-15 this season with first-overall pick Bryce Young on the roster. It will be tough sledding for whoever takes over both positions. […]


Commanders Fire Head Coach Ron Rivera

The Washington Commanders have fired head coach Ron Rivera. Rivera spent four seasons in the nation's capital, never leading the team to a winning record, although he did make one postseason appearance in his first season at the helm. Rivera took the Commanders to a 4-13 record this season, the second-worst mark in the league. […]
